Transaction 40e142b0573dc2fe5e94d56b6acf560ea4eadb723d5766d40b34e015b5a61837
1 Input
2 Outputs
- 40e142b0573dc2fe5e94d56b6acf560ea4eadb723d5766d40b34e015b5a61837:0
- 40e142b0573dc2fe5e94d56b6acf560ea4eadb723d5766d40b34e015b5a61837:1
value 936425
address 1BznHBP91e2EHZWFiWeHkei749okR1i75M
value 3366715
address 15HNfeSszfma5VeBgTqwjDmWp3MrKZZSaw